Zero-G, the space entertainment and tourism company that offers customers the opportunity to experience weightlessness in an airplane, has announced their newest special flight. The Platinum Experience will feature Apollo Moon-walker Buzz Aldrin as coach and guide for a flight on 3 November 2007 from Las Vegas, Nevada.
“Only a very few people have the opportunity to experience zero gravity. Even fewer will be able to do so with one of the few men whose own adventures in weightlessness sparked our imaginations; who unleashed our own inner dreamer, inner astronaut, inner flyer.”
The three or four hour experience includes about 90 minutes in the air. During that hour and a half, the modified Boeing 727 flies 15 parabolic arcs, each providing about 30 seconds of weightlessness. The standard fee for the experience is $3,500. Perhaps their most famous customer to date was Professor Stephen Hawking, who flew on 26 April 2007.
For the special Platinum Experience with Buzz Aldrin, however, there are a few changes. The fee is $8,900, but there will only be 16 places, affording far more maneuvering room (the regular flights take 35 people). In addition, customers on this flight will get a special Nomex flight suit, a special dinner with Aldrin, and an expanded “regravitation party” after the flight (which is normally a champagne toast and some food, giving participants a chance to relive their new experience).
